Waterloo Capital L.P. Increases Position in Newmont Corporation $NEM

Waterloo Capital L.P. raised its stake in shares of Newmont Corporation (NYSE:NEMFree Report) by 230.0%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 14,369 shares of the basic materials company’s stock after purchasing an additional 10,015 shares during the period. Waterloo Capital L.P.’s holdings in Newmont were worth $1,435,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Newmont Stock Down 0.2%

Shares of Newmont stock opened at $109.60 on Monday. The company has a fifty day moving average price of $110.89 and a 200 day moving average price of $109.10. The company has a current ratio of 2.44, a quick ratio of 2.17 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15. Newmont Corporation has a twelve month low of $51.80 and a twelve month high of $134.88. The stock has a market cap of $117.01 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 14.22 and a beta of 0.42.

Newmont (NYSE:NEMG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 23rd. The basic materials company reported $2.90 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.07 by $0.83. Newmont had a net margin of 33.87% and a return on equity of 27.84%. The firm had revenue of $7.31 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$6.83 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$1.25 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 45.8%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ts forecast that Newmont Corporation will post 9.72 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Newmont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 22nd. Investors of record on Wednesday, May 27th will be issued a dividend of $0.26 per share. This represents a $1.04 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.9%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, May 27th. Newmont’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 13.49%.

Newmont Company Profile

(Free Report)

Newmont Corporation (NYSE: NEM) is a leading global gold mining company engaged in the exploration, development, processing and reclamation of gold properties. The company’s core business centers on the production of gold, with additional byproduct metals produced from its operations. Newmont operates a portfolio of long?lived mines and development projects, and its activities span the full mine life cycle from early-stage exploration through to mining, milling and closure.

Founded in 1921 and headquartered in Greenwood Village, Colorado, Newmont has grown through organic development and strategic acquisitions.
